Transaction d39c8f5cf2eadaf512a8226198e5e352616019608148dd75d02768a41c065ad3
1 Input
1 Output
-
d39c8f5cf2eadaf512a8226198e5e352616019608148dd75d02768a41c065ad3:0
- value
- 574983
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6d8de097ff87ede5c4997270094284763148a4a OP_EQUAL
- address
- 3KpRWjSibDxEWBiq67fFNG3TS9xdk4Frw4